Di Punto

Location: Di Punto


Rating: OK
Meal: Wine and appetizers for 2
Price: 5000? yen
Payment: Cash only
Dishes: Bottle of wine, gorgonzola stuffed shiitake mushrooms, creamy oyster bake
English Menu: Yes
Smoking:No


Di Punto is a wine bar right next to Chuo station that my wife and I have been meaning to try for some time.  Our "date night" was up last week so we decided to try it out.  If we liked it we might stay for dinner, otherwise we were just there for wine and appetizers.


We ordered a bottle of shiraz wine, which might have been pretty good except for the fact that the bottle was ice cold when it arrived, and no amount of cupping the glass would warm up the wine to room temperature.  Quite a misstep for a wine bar in my opinion.


The gorgonzola stuffed shiitake mushrooms was tasty, but spendy for the two little things.  But I did take the idea home and make the same thing but better (and far cheaper) for dinner the next night!  The oyster bake dish wasn't all that great.


It's a nice date spot, but it gets very crowded towards dinner time proper, and I don't think the food deserved the price.  Needless to say, we found another spot for dinner that night.
